    The Union for African Population Studies (UAPS) is a non-profit making Pan-African organization that aims to promote the scientific study of population and the application of research evidence in development planning in Africa.     Finance, Grants and Operations Manager

    The Finance, Grants and Operations Manager will:

    • Supervise all grant management and reporting on grant performance.
    • Manage financial and technical processes to ensure best use of resources by preparing sound budgets, monitoring project expenses and ensuring timely preparation of donor financial reports.
    • Manage all accounting and banking functions for the organization and track budgets both for internal purposes and reporting to donors.
    • Review and consolidate monthly financial reports to ensure accuracy and to provide regular feedback as well as for distribution to the UAPS Council.
    • Confirm availability of funds for all requests for payment or charges to grants.
    • Prepare quarterly reports, projections and any other required donor submissions.
    • Prepare a consolidated annual fiscal report.
    • Organize and prepare the required documents for annual external audits.
    • Prepare and revise finance and operation guidelines to adhere to requirements.
    • Oversee the day-to-day financial and administrative operations of UAPS.
    • Develop business growth plans, including financial targets, and ongoing performance and evaluation.
    • Respond to any other request as required.

    Academic Qualifications

    • At least a Bachelor’s degree in finance, or other relevant fields.
    • Professional qualification in Accounting will be an added advantage.

    Knowledge, Skills and Experience

    • A minimum of 10 years’ working experience in the management of programs funded by international donors.
    • In-depth knowledge of financial management rules and regulations, including International Public Sector Accounting Standards.
    • Demonstrated capacity and prior experience in managing the personnel, administrative and logistical functions of programs and projects.
    • Excellent analytical, leadership and interpersonal skills.
    • Demonstrated ability to lead and work effectively in team situations.
    • Proven ability to prepare budgets and donor financial reports.
    • Demonstrated capacity and prior experience in supervising others as a coach/mentor to train and develop their skills, including financial and management skills.
    • Excellent oral and written communication skills.
    • Knowledge of the French language will be an added advantage.
